Comprehending IELTS

Before diving into the registration process, it's important to understand what the IELTS entails. The IELTS test assesses 4 language skills: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are 2 kinds of IELTS tests:

  1. IELTS Academic - for those aiming to pursue greater education or expert registration.
  2. IELTS General Training - for those moving to an English-speaking nation or obtaining secondary education.

Secret Components of the IELTS Exam

PartPeriodDescription
Listening30 minutesFour taped texts that test listening comprehension.
Reading60 minutes3 sections with different texts, screening reading skills.
Writing60 minutes2 jobs-- one for describing details and one for essay writing.
Speaking11-14 minutesAn oral interview with an inspector.

How to Register for IELTS Online in Pakistan

Step 1: Visit the Official Website

To start the registration procedure, head to the main British Council or IDP IELTS site. These organizations coordinate IELTS screening in Pakistan.

Action 2: Create an Account

  1. Click on the 'Register' or 'Sign Up' button.
  2. Complete the required details, such as your name, email address, and a safe and secure password.
  3. Verify your email address through the verification link sent out to your inbox.

Step 3: Choose Your Test Type

Upon visiting, pick the kind of test you wish to carry out-- Academic or General Training.

Step 4: Select Your Test Center & & Date

A list of readily available test centers in Pakistan will be displayed. Typical locations include:

  • Karachi
  • Lahore
  • Islamabad
  • Faisalabad
  • Peshawar
  • Choose a hassle-free test date that matches your schedule. Ensure that you sign up well in advance, as slots tend to fill up quickly.

Step 5: Fill Out Your Personal Information

Offer the required individual information, consisting of:

  • Full name (based on your passport)
  • Nationality
  • Passport/ID number
  • Contact details

Action 6: Pay the Registration Fee

The IELTS test fee varies depending on the test center. The existing fee in Pakistan is approximately PKR 38,000 to PKR 40,000. Payment approaches usually accepted consist of:

  • Credit/Debit Card
  • Bank Transfer

Step 7: Confirm Your Registration

As soon as the payment is finished, you will get a confirmation e-mail including your test details. Make sure to keep this safe, as you will need it on the test day.

Common FAQs about IELTS Registration in Pakistan

1. Can  Andrew IELTS  change my test date or test center after registration?

Yes, you can change your test date or center, but this normally needs a fee. Consult the screening organization for their particular policies.

2. What recognition do I require to bring to the test?

You need to bring the very same recognition file you utilized throughout registration (either your passport or National ID).

3. How long does it require to get IELTS results?

You will get your outcomes within 13 days from the test date. You can see your outcomes online or get a paper copy by post.

4. Can I retake the IELTS test if I am not pleased with my rating?

Yes, you can retake the IELTS test as numerous times as you want. It is suggested to prepare properly before trying once again.

5. Exists any age limitation for taking the IELTS?

While there is no rigorous age limit, it is suggested that test-takers be at least 16 years old.
